In 2012 I graduated from UWM Peck School of the Arts with a bachelor degree in art and a minor in art history. After graduating I got swept up in the fast current of the daily grind and I lost my pull to make art. Until I happened upon the Art Mill.
I now share a space with two other artists inside the Mill. This special little space helped me to revive my need to make art and regain the feeling of being my most authentic self. I’m currently teaching preschool art classes at the NSAA and working on a new painting series. Come by the Arts Mill and visit my little room of inspiration!
